现在位置: 首页 > interlock发表的所有文章
  • 09月
  • 20日
综合 ⁄ 共 124字 评论关闭
oracle 11g数据库备份dmp文件导入oracle 10g的时候,会报错,需要转换dmp文件版本,下面是一种简单方式,留给自己和跟自己一样迷茫的朋友,废话不多说,直接开啦。。。 软件下载地址:软件下载地址! 1.打开软件 2.选择dmp文件 3.修改版本
阅读全文
  • 09月
  • 09日
移动开发 ⁄ 共 2684字 评论关闭
看到android5.0版本中提供了  elevation  的功能,我在SDK Manager 下载了 Android 5.0  例子代码,看了下  ElevationBasic 例子,展示了2个view对象,一个圆形一个矩形,圆形设置了 android:elevation  =  30dp,具体例子如下   <?xml version="1.0" encoding="utf-8"?> <!-- Copyright 2014 The Android Open Source Project Licensed under the Apache License, Version 2.0 (the "License"); you may not use this file except in compliance with the License. You may obtain a copy of th......
阅读全文
  • 09月
  • 25日
综合 ⁄ 共 177字 评论关闭
最近到新公司用的代码管理工具是svn,于是学习了下。 SVN基本操作介绍: http://jingyan.baidu.com/article/6c67b1d6f524d52787bb1ef3.html svn tag,branch,trunck介绍(与版控相关): http://developer.51cto.com/art/201005/201718.html
阅读全文
  • 08月
  • 13日
综合 ⁄ 共 2726字 评论关闭
  软件构件化是21世纪软件工业发展的大势趋。工业化的软件复用已经从通用类库进化到了面向领域的应用框架。Gartner Group认为:“到2003年,至少70%的新应用将主要建立在如软件构件和应用框架这类‘构造块’之上;应用开发的未来就在于提供一开放体系结构,以方便构件的选择、组装和集成”。框架的重用已成为软件生产中最有效的重用方式之一。然而—— 一、构件与框架有何关系? 1. 什么是框架? 框架(Framework)是整个或部分系统的可重用设计,表现为一组抽象构件及构件实例间交互的方法;另一种定义认为,框架是可被应用开发者定......
阅读全文
  • 07月
  • 29日
综合 ⁄ 共 2497字 评论关闭
我们已知道类具备封装和信息隐 藏的特性。只有类的成员函数才能访问类的私有成员,程式中的其他函数是无法访问私有成员的。非成员函数能够访问类中的公有成员,但是假如将数据成员都定义 为公有的,这又破坏了隐藏的特性。另外,应该看到在某些情况下,特别是在对某些成员函数多次调用时,由于参数传递,类型检查和安全性检查等都需要时间开 销,而影响程式的运行效率。   为了解决上述问题,提出一种使用友元的方案。友元是一种定义在类外部的普通函数,但他需要在类体内进行说 明,为了和该类的成员函数加以区别,在说明时前面......
阅读全文
  • 06月
  • 09日
综合 ⁄ 共 527字 评论关闭
有个三列布局:   <div id="left">...</div> <div id="middle">...</div> <div id="right">...</div>   样式上已经给三个div加了宽度和左浮动,布局没问题。   程序员要把右面的div用iframe来实现,即把#right的浮动和宽度加到了iframe上面,<div id="right">...</div>放到了iframe里面。如下:   <div id="left">...</div> <div id="middle">...</div>  <iframe>    <div id="right">...</div>  </iframe>   iframe的高度是由......
阅读全文
  • 05月
  • 07日
综合 ⁄ 共 1095字 评论关闭
这个问题是很久以前就发现的问题一直没有整理,今天有个朋友又问到这个问题。 先看一个mysql表结构 Sql代码 CREATE   TABLE  `test` (     `TYPEID` int (2)    ) ENGINE=MyISAM CHARSET=latin1;   对于test表字段中的typeId 后面的 int(2)中的2代表的到底是什么含义。        对于大多数的人来说我们马上想到的是varchar(2)后面的2代表为两个字节,也就不难把int后的2误认为2位即typeId的最大存入的数为99【俺以前也一直这么认为的】 。 对于mysql的int来说它的长度是不变的及为4个字节、对于插入数据数据大小也是......
阅读全文
  • 04月
  • 25日
综合 ⁄ 共 2159字 评论关闭
题意:给定平面坐标上n(n<=100000)个点,然后在其中选一个,使得所有点到当前点的Manhattan距离和Chebyshev距离和最小。          平面上两点间的 Manhattan 距离为 |x1-x2| + |y1-y2|,平面上两点间的 Chebyshev距离为 max(|x1-x2|, |y1-y2|)。 题解:扫描线算法,对于Manhattan距离将x y方向坐标分开处理,分别求出当前坐标到其他坐标的x(y)距离和,然后扫描所有的点,二分确定位置更新答案;          对于原坐标系中两点间的Chebyshev距离,将坐标轴顺时针旋转45度,所有点的坐标值放大sqrt(2)倍所得到的新坐标系中的Ma......
阅读全文
  • 04月
  • 19日
综合 ⁄ 共 1030字 评论关闭
转自:http://blog.csdn.net/zhy_cheng/article/details/7954423 通过AnimationListener可以监听Animation的运行过程 [java] view plaincopy AnimationSet as=new AnimationSet(true);               RotateAnimation al=new RotateAnimation(0,-720,Animation.RELATIVE_TO_PARENT,0.5f,Animation.RELATIVE_TO_PARENT,0.5f);               al.setDuration(3000);               al.setAnimationListener(new AnimationListener(){                      public void onAnimationStart(Animation animation) { ......
阅读全文
  • 04月
  • 11日
综合 ⁄ 共 2858字 评论关闭
 引 言   随着社会信息交流需求的急剧增加、个人移动通信的迅速普及,频谱已成为越来越宝贵的资源。天线技术采用空分复用(SDMA),利用在信号传播方向上的差别,将同频率、同时隙的信号区分开来。它可以成倍地扩展通信容量,并和其他复用技术相结合,最大限度地利用有限的频谱资源。另外在移动通信中,由于复杂的地形、建筑物结构对电波传播的影响,大量用户间的相互影响,产生时延扩散、瑞利衰落、多径、共信道干扰等,使通信质量受到严重影响。采用智能天线可以有效的解决这个问题。   目前迫切需要解决的是语音、视频和数......
阅读全文
  • 03月
  • 30日
综合 ⁄ 共 13464字 评论关闭
一、计算素数(prime number)     定义:质数,又称素数,指在大于1的自然数中,除了1和此整数自身外,无法被其他自然数整除的数(也可定义为只有1和本身两个因数的数)。(摘自维基百科:质数)     素数判定,或素性测试,是检验一个给定的整数是否为素数的测试。(摘自维基百科:素性测试)     思考:可以查阅这方面的资料,了解各种实现算法的原理和意义,利用本文所说的性能监视工具,对这几种算法进行对比和调优,并进行调优的记录(应当包括算法调优和数据结构调优)。要注意的是:工程上使用时分两种:一种是算法产生质......
阅读全文
  • 01月
  • 12日
综合 ⁄ 共 1811字 评论关闭
Can you solve this equation? Time Limit : 2000/1000ms (Java/Other)   Memory Limit : 32768/32768K (Java/Other) Total Submission(s) : 87   Accepted Submission(s) : 18 Font: Times New Roman | Verdana | Georgia Font Size: ← → Problem Description Now,given the equation 8*x^4 + 7*x^3 + 2*x^2 + 3*x + 6 == Y,can you find its solution between 0 and 100; Now please try your lucky. Input The first line of the input contains an integer T(1<=T<=100) which means the number of test cases.......
阅读全文